Double Glazing Window Repairs

If you notice condensation on the window panes, it is time to repair double glazing. This is typically a cheaper option than replacing the entire unit.

However you should seek assistance from a professional since it's a risky and difficult task. It requires specialized tools and knowledge about window and joinery mechanisms.

Replacement of the seals

Occasionally the seals between the panes of your double-glazed windows may get damaged. This is usually the reason for mist between the windows or condensation. If it is not treated, it could result in moisture entering your home that can cause damage to the wooden frames, cause drafts and even make it difficult to open and close your window or doors. If you notice any of these issues with your double glazed windows, it is suggested to consult a glazier or window specialist to address the issue.

The expert will take the glass from the frame and then replace it with a brand new gas that blocks air from entering through the gap. The expert will then apply a sealant so that it doesn't happen again.

It's only a temporary fix however it will stop any moisture from getting trapped inside your double-glazed windows and ensure that it is functional. It is not suitable for Argon gas-filled windows however.

Hardware Replacement

The hinges, locking mechanisms and handles of double-glazed windows may also be damaged at times. This can make it difficult to open and close the window or it might be noisy. In many cases, the damage to the handle or hinge can be repaired. If the lock is totally broken, it needs to be replaced.

A common problem is when doors or windows begin to shrink or even drop. This is often caused by extreme temperatures causing the frame to shrink or expand. In this case wiping frames with cold water will aid in shrinking them slightly. The hinges or the mechanism may need to be oiled.

It is always a good idea to contact the company that installed your double glazing if you have any problems. They can provide you with advice on the best course of action. In some cases, the issue is resolved by resealing seals. In some cases the entire glass unit could need to be replaced.

Double-glazed windows may fog up or develop condensation between the glass panes. This is an indication of a damaged seal and the need to replace it. In most cases replacing the glass allows you to keep the existing window frames. This is a less expensive option than having them replaced.
